IMonitoringService.TestCheckAsync Method |
This API is preliminary and subject to change.
Test a monitoring check.
Namespace: net.openstack.Providers.RackspaceAssembly: openstacknet (in openstacknet.dll) Version: 1.7.7+Branch.master.Sha.25d803f397c8693c2c13777ef6675f796f520f2c
SyntaxTask<ReadOnlyCollection<CheckData>> TestCheckAsync(
EntityId entityId,
NewCheckConfiguration configuration,
Nullable<bool> debug,
CancellationToken cancellationToken
)
Function TestCheckAsync (
entityId As EntityId,
configuration As NewCheckConfiguration,
debug As Nullable(Of Boolean),
cancellationToken As CancellationToken
) As Task(Of ReadOnlyCollection(Of CheckData))
Task<ReadOnlyCollection<CheckData^>^>^ TestCheckAsync(
EntityId^ entityId,
NewCheckConfiguration^ configuration,
Nullable<bool> debug,
CancellationToken cancellationToken
)
abstract TestCheckAsync :
entityId : EntityId *
configuration : NewCheckConfiguration *
debug : Nullable<bool> *
cancellationToken : CancellationToken -> Task<ReadOnlyCollection<CheckData>>
Parameters
- entityId
- Type: net.openstack.Providers.Rackspace.Objects.Monitoring.EntityId
The entity ID. This is obtained from Entity.Id. - configuration
- Type: net.openstack.Providers.Rackspace.Objects.Monitoring.NewCheckConfiguration
A NewCheckConfiguration object describing the check to test. - debug
- Type: System.Nullable<Boolean>
true to include debug information in the result; otherwise, false. If the value is null, a provider-specific default is used. - cancellationToken
- Type: System.Threading.CancellationToken
The CancellationToken that the task will observe.
Return Value
Type:
Task<ReadOnlyCollection<CheckData>>
A
Task object representing the asynchronous operation. When
the task completes successfully, the
Result
property will contain a collection
CheckData objects describing
the test results.
Version Information.NET Framework
Supported in: 4.5
openstack.net
Supported in: 1.6, 1.5, 1.4, 1.3.6
See Also